About Client Relationship Executive

What does a Client Relationship Executive do?

In the role of Client Relationship Executive, our primary responsibility is to ask in-depth questions from the customers to understand their financial situations and mindsets. We have the ability to deliver the software services to the customers by convincing them and satisfying them with the company's quality standards. Working as Client Relationship Executives, we are accountable for coordinating with the sales department of the company to identify more business opportunities within the existing customer base. We also prepare documents based on the results of current activities and update the salesforce department about it. We provide continuous feedback to the management and leadership teams for ensuring the proper execution of given tasks.

Core tasks:

  • assisting sales and marketing teams
  • consulting the customers of the company
  • participating in customer meetings whenever required
  • performing other duties as assigned

What Is the Age and Gender Ratio of Client Relationship Executive Employees?
Gender ratio in Client Relationship Executive position: 0.597785977859779 Male and 0.402214022140221 Female. Age ratio in Client Relationship Executive position: 16-20: 3%, 21-30: 37%, 31-40: 30%, 41-50: 21%, 51-60: 8%, 60+: 1%. Client Relationship Executive position is predominantly male (59.8%) with the largest age group being 21-30 years old, followed by 31-40 years old.

What Industries Does Client Relationship Executive Typically Have Experience In?
Industry Background: The most typical industries of Client Relationship Executive: Information Technology, Professional / Scientific / Technical, Finance & Insurance, Administrative & Support, Manufacturing. Client Relationship Executive employees most likely come from a Information Technology industry background.
